Description
Scope of Work: UG & OH - Beginning from an existing 2” Poly line stubbed in from the street by United Water, run 83’ of 2” CPVC under ground piping out and stub up into an existing 2,502-ft/2 single story 10 bed assisted living facility. From the supply, install a 1.5” Back Flow Device and wet riser. The wet system will serve out this existing structure in accordance with NFPA 13D. System shall be equipped with an alarm initiating device and an outside alarm. All fire sprinkler work and related, which includes dual use, single service water supply, the system backflow prevention device (provided by others), shall be per IFC2006 903, NFPA 13D, approved plans, engineering/red-lining and attached review comments, under direction of the Fire Chief.
